Market Street is in Whitworth, Rochdale and in Rossendale district. OL12 8TF is located in the Whitworth elect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Rossendale and Darwen.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

Safety

Is Market Street d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Market Street was 35.8 per 1,000 residents, which is 61.8% lower than the Whitworth average. The most reported crime type was Anti-social behaviour.

Market Street has the 5th lowest crime rate of 25 local areas in Whitworth and the 50th lowest crime rate of 224 local areas in Rossendale .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 7.2 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been falling year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-34.8%.

Employment

OL12 8TF area has a high level of entrepreneurship. Only 17% of streets have higher percent of entrepreneur residents. 13% of population in this area is self-employed, while the average in the UK is 9.7%. High number of entrepreneurs usually leads to relatively high economic growth, higher paid jobs and better quality of life in the area.

OL12 8TF area has a low unemployment rate. According to Census 2021, 2% residents of this area were unemployed, while the average in the UK was 4.83%. A low level of unemployment in an area indicates a strong job market, where most people who are seeking work can find employment. This generally reflects a healthy economy in the area.
